 | | [ANN] pbFORTH 1.0.5 for RCX
|
|
Finally, I have got pbFORTH to where I can release it again. It now has: - A simple cooperative tasker - A marker word so you can erase things easily - Support for poweroff - High res (10msec) count down and stop timers - Various and sundry fixes (...)
